I swapped to facial wash from plain soap when my skin started going red after washing and I have always tried to find a cheap but effective product. I have been using the Boots own range until recently. When my usual product ran out I needed a replacement and saw this Olay 'Gentle Cleansers' Refreshing Face Wash on offer in Morrisons supermarket for only £1.49, reduced from it's usual price of £2.99. Olay is a brand I'm familiar with having used their moisturisers in the past and so was a brand name I trusted.
The product comes in a squeezy tube which stand on it's lid. This is a flip style lid which has a large lip for easy opening and which clicks simply back into place, keeping the product inside the tube secure and preventing any leakage. The plastic of the tube is very soft and malleable so it's easy to exert pressure onto the tube and dispenser the facial wash.
The tube size is 150ml which is about average size and which was the same size as most other facial wash products I looked at on the shelves. The product has information printed on the back of the tube which tells me everything I need to know about using it.
Olay say this product will leave you with "simply clean, refreshed, beautiful skin". They state proudly that the face wash is dermatologically tested and is "non-comedogenic" (a science term that has gone right over my head). They also explain that this wash has extracts of aloe and cucumber which "lifts away dirt and make up". The tube is printed on front with the skin type this face wash is aimed at and I think Olay are hedging their bets as it says it's suitable for "normal, dry and combination skin"!
I always use facial wash at night before I go to bed to remove any dirt or make up from that day. I am used to using just a smidgen of facial wash and with this Olay face wash I can also get away with using a tiny amount - just a fingernail sized dollop of this stuff cleans my whole face and neck effectively.
The clear gel is very dense and thick and does not run when you squeeze it out. I find it necessary to rub it into my hands to get it to spread and to create a lather. This creates a fine smattering of bubbles which I then apply to my damp face.
The gel has a lovely fragrance which you can smell as you use the product. It's sweet, flowery and a little bit aquatic or ocean-inspired.
The gel feels soft and fluffy as I'm using it but as I massage it into my skin I can feel a kind of moisturising effect taking place. It's as if I'm applying some kind of balm to my skin which after I've rinsed away the gel I can feel has penetrated my skin. It's very easy to rinse off too and never stings my eyes at all. The gel leaves my skin feeling springy and smooth and I feel like I could get away with not using a night cream if I wanted to do so.
I know from having followed up using this face wash with a cleanser that the gel effectively removes all impurities and make-up, even in difficult areas like around the eye.
I have to say that in comparison with the Boots products I have been using this face wash is a much superior product and one that I'd like to keep using in the future.
